new orleans louisiana cdv photos 1860s id'd boy & father? civil war tax stamp papal common in this size ofTwo original CDVs of a boy and a man, both by New Orleans photographers, the man's with a Civil War revenue stamp, the boy's with an identification in pencil. The boy was George Brentford Mitchell (Feb 1862 Nov 1920), and although not identified, the man might have been George's father, Archibald (1819 1885). Young George is shown wearing Scottish sash.
